It’s an awesome scene, but is it, er, possible? Could you do this yourself?Of course, the great thing about movies is that they don’t need to be realistic (and the Pirates franchise makes the most of that exemption) I’m only asking about this because it’s a fun way to do some physics and understand how the world works So grab your goggles and let’s plunge in!What Floats Your Boat?It may not seem like it, but objects in the water still have gravity acting on them, same as on land
